If you’re planning a day trip that combines history, culture, scenic views, and a touch of Italian charm, Formia should be at the top of your list. Nestled between Rome and Naples along the stunning Tyrrhenian coast, this hidden gem offers more than just beaches. From ancient ruins to vibrant markets and scenic promenades, Formia is a place that can make even a short visit unforgettable. Let me show you how to make the most out of a single day in this captivating town.

1. Stroll Along Formia’s Seafront Promenade

There’s no better way to start your day than with a leisurely walk along Formia’s seafront promenade. The wide pedestrian walkway stretches along the coastline, offering breathtaking views of the Tyrrhenian Sea. You can watch fishermen cast their lines, sailboats glide by, and the sun sparkle on the water. From my own personal experience, the morning light here is magical and provides perfect photo opportunities without the crowds that often plague more popular Italian seaside towns.

Take your time and soak in the salty breeze—it’s the kind of moment that makes you forget the rush of everyday life. Stop at one of the cafés lining the promenade for a cappuccino and a cornetto to fuel up for the day ahead.

2. Explore the Roman Ruins of Villa of Mamurra

Formia has a rich history dating back to Roman times, and the Villa of Mamurra is a must-see for anyone interested in archaeology and ancient architecture. This villa once belonged to Gaius Mamurra, a wealthy Roman known for his extravagant lifestyle. Today, the ruins tell stories of luxury with remnants of mosaic floors, columns, and bath areas.

Walking through the villa, you can almost imagine the bustle of Roman life, the echoes of ancient conversations, and the opulence of the era. If you love history, this site will transport you back in time. Make sure to bring comfortable shoes and a sunhat—there’s a lot to explore under the Italian sun.

3. Visit the Medieval Tower of Castellone

Standing tall on a hill overlooking the town, the Castellone Tower is a medieval fortress that offers panoramic views of Formia and its surroundings. The climb up is worth every step. As you ascend, you’ll pass through old stone pathways and defensive walls that hint at the town’s strategic importance throughout history.

Once at the top, take a moment to breathe in the sweeping vistas—on a clear day, you can see the Pontine Islands in the distance. From my overall experience, there’s nothing quite like standing atop an ancient fortress with the breeze brushing your face and realizing just how much history this town has witnessed.

4. Relax at Vindicio Beach

After a morning of exploring, it’s time to unwind at Vindicio Beach. This sandy stretch is perfect for sunbathing, swimming, or just enjoying the sound of waves crashing gently against the shore. The water is clear, and the setting is picturesque, making it ideal for photography, a picnic, or simply a moment of calm.

Formia’s beaches are less crowded than those in neighboring towns like Sperlonga, giving you a chance to enjoy a more peaceful seaside experience. Pack your swimsuit and a beach towel—you’ll want to stay longer than planned.

5. Discover the Sanctuary of the Three Fountains

Tucked slightly away from the center of Formia, the Sanctuary of the Three Fountains is a spiritual and historical site that attracts visitors seeking tranquility and beauty. According to legend, the site marks the place where Saint Erasmus performed miracles. The surrounding gardens and small chapel provide a serene escape from the busy streets.

Take your time to wander the paths, listen to the gentle trickle of the fountains, and appreciate the peaceful atmosphere. Even if you’re not particularly religious, the combination of history, architecture, and natural beauty makes this a spot worth visiting.

6. Wander Through Formia’s Historic Center

No trip to Formia is complete without wandering its historic center. Narrow streets, colorful buildings, and quaint piazzas give the town its unique charm. Stop at local shops for souvenirs, sample pastries at a family-run bakery, and watch life unfold as locals go about their day.

Pay attention to the small details—ancient doorways, intricate balconies, and the occasional fountain tucked into a corner. From my own personal experience, the best way to explore Formia’s heart is simply by walking without a strict plan and letting curiosity guide you.

7. Check Out the Roman Cisterns of Caposele

For a glimpse into ancient engineering, the Roman Cisterns of Caposele are fascinating. These large underground structures were built to store water and supply the town during Roman times. Walking through the cisterns, you’ll notice the clever architectural techniques that allowed these systems to last for centuries.

It’s an unusual but intriguing stop that gives a different perspective on Formia’s past. Bring a flashlight if possible, as some areas are dimly lit, adding to the sense of adventure.

8. Enjoy Fresh Seafood at a Local Trattoria

Italian coastal towns are famous for their seafood, and Formia does not disappoint. Around lunchtime, head to a local trattoria to enjoy fresh catches like spaghetti alle vongole, grilled fish, or calamari. The flavors are simple yet extraordinary, showcasing the quality of the local ingredients.

From my overall experience, the best meals are often found in small, family-run restaurants rather than the ones with flashy menus. Don’t be shy—ask the staff for their recommendations or the catch of the day.

9. Take a Boat Ride to the Pontine Islands

If you have time, consider a short boat excursion to the nearby Pontine Islands. These small islands boast crystal-clear waters, hidden coves, and a sense of untouched beauty. Even a brief ride provides a different perspective of Formia and its coastline.

Many local operators offer guided tours or private boat rentals. Watching the town recede into the distance from the water is an unforgettable experience, offering both relaxation and a touch of adventure.

10. Cap Your Day at Monte Orlando Park

As the day winds down, Monte Orlando Park is the perfect spot to catch the sunset and reflect on your Formia adventure. The park is dotted with walking paths, scenic lookouts, and lush greenery. Hike up one of the trails for a higher vantage point and enjoy panoramic views of the sea and town below.

It’s a peaceful way to end a day packed with exploration. From my own personal experience, sunsets here feel like a reward, a gentle reminder of why Formia is such a special place to visit—even if just for a day.


Formia may not have the fame of Rome or Naples, but that’s part of its charm. A day trip here offers a blend of history, culture, nature, and culinary delights that few towns can match. Whether you’re walking along the seaside, exploring ancient ruins, or savoring fresh seafood, Formia has a way of making you feel like you’ve truly discovered something special.